MONTREAL – The arson squad is investigating a suspicious fire in an apartment building in Montreal’s Park Extension neighbourhood.
The fire broke at out around 9:30 p.m. in the interior stairwell of a two-storey residential building located on Durocher Street, according to Montreal police.

Certain elements discovered at the scene indicate foul-play, Montreal police spokesperson, Jean-Pierre Brabant told Global News.
“A suitcase was put on fire in the hallway,” Brabant said.
According to Brabant, the fire was extinguished very quickly and there was very little damage to the building.

There were no reports of injury, as no one was in the building at the time.
Officers met with witnesses last night and investigators were back at the scene Sunday morning.
